Responsibilities
The job of a support engineer covers the entire support cycle, from triage and escalate to resolution. They make sure that applications run at their best. They also troubleshoot technical problems and offer step-by–step guidance for customers. They answer customer questions, escalate important technical issues to IT engineers, create error reports and monitor performance metrics. The responsibilities of support engineering can vary depending on the company but are usually described as follows.
Support engineers' primary duties are to improve customer satisfaction and service. Their job involves monitoring and evaluating customer satisfaction. They also have to develop service metrics and implement changes to improve customer satisfaction. They are responsible for reporting service escalations and contributing to product improvements. They communicate with managers to evaluate customer feedback and create a more efficient, effective support environment. Some support engineers advance to executive-level positions.
